Document Description
The proposed Niguel Shores Water Service Replacements Project (Project) involves the removal and replacement of 20 water services, 5 fire hydrant assemblies, and 5 valve/tee assemblies along Periwinkle Drive and Leeward Drive within the Niguel Shores Community Association in the City of Dana Point (City). The South Coast Water District (SCWD) would serve as the lead agency for this proposed Project. The proposed Project site is located within a residential community surrounded by an urban environment including roads and single-family homes. The proposed Project would involve the following activities – removal and replacement of 20 water service lines, 5 fire hydrants, and 5 valve/tee assemblies; modification of existing facilities as required to facilitate interface and connection to new improvements; disinfection of piping to local and State Health Department standards; connection of new piping to the existing water system; and removal and replacement of pavement to restore paving and sitework to preconstruction conditions. All improvements would be located within SCWD’s water service area on public right-of-way (ROW) or a private residential road in the Niguel Shores Community.

Notice of Exemption

Exempt Status
Categorical Exemption
Type, Section or Code
Section 15302 (Class 2 - Replacement or Reconstruction)
Reasons for Exemption
The project is limited to the removal and replacement of existing outdated water service infrastructure and is categorically exempt under Section 15302, Class 2(c) which includes the replacement or reconstruction of existing utility systems and/or facilities involving negligible or no expansion of capacity.
